Responded to service call for noisy outdoor compressor unit on 7-year-old residential air conditioning system. Upon arrival, performed diagnostic inspection of the outdoor condensing unit and identified the issue as a failing capacitor. Removed access panel to inspect electrical components and confirmed the Dayton brand capacitor showed signs of deterioration and was causing abnormal operational noise. Replaced defective capacitor with properly rated OEM equivalent unit, secured all electrical connections, and verified proper wire routing. Tested system operation to ensure compressor started smoothly without noise, confirmed proper amperage draw, and verified cooling cycle functioned correctly. Reinstalled access panel and left system running normally.
Performed diagnostic service on 6-7 year old air conditioning system experiencing inadequate cooling capacity during peak daytime heat load. Upon inspection, found evaporator coil heavily contaminated with dust, dirt, and debris accumulation restricting airflow and reducing heat transfer efficiency. Measured supply air temperature at 53.5°F, confirming unit is producing cooling but insufficient airflow through fouled coil is preventing system from maintaining thermostat setpoint until outdoor ambient temperatures decrease after sunset. Documented coil condition and temperature readings. Recommended thorough coil cleaning to restore proper airflow and system capacity.

Responded to call back on recent AC installation that failed inspection due to condensation leaking into furnace cabinet. Upon arrival, inspected evaporator coil assembly and drainage system. Found improperly pitched or clogged condensate drain line allowing water to overflow from drain pan into furnace cabinet. Cleared drain line obstruction, verified proper pitch and drainage flow, and confirmed condensate is now routing correctly away from unit. Tested system operation and verified no moisture intrusion into cabinet.
